Features

  • Effective Maintenance: Ideal for spring openings and routine care, reducing algae growth with a long-lasting copper-based formula
  • Powerful Algae Control: Highly concentrated to eliminate yellow and mustard algae with small, easy-to-measure doses
  • Stain Protection: Formulated with 23.5% copper triethanolamine and 7.1% chelated copper to prevent pool staining
  • Swim-Ready Safety: Free of harmful chemicals, allowing immediate swimming after application
  • User-Friendly Formula: Non-foaming, low-odor, and perfect for those sensitive to strong chemical smells

This product works great for us, no algae. I use along with Pool RX and Burn out 73 it keeps everything under control. Arizona summers can be a struggle against algae otherwise. We have been pool owners for 6yrs. We had no idea what we were doing originally. Struggled about 2yrs. We had issues with algae, first green than mustard. L----- pool supply just kept telling us to do this and that. The amout and cost of products just kept getting bigger. So we found another pool store and were told to get a good algaecide, clean everything and shock the heck out of it. We looked at tons of algaecides, read reviews and my husband finally found this algaecide on Amazon. We added the initial dosage, 6oz for our 15,000 gallon pool than burshed down the pool and ran the pool pump for 24hrs. The next day we sprayed the pool filters clean and soaked them in a large tub of water with a half bag of Burn out 73, removed vacuum, hoses and leaf basket scrubbed them clean and soaked in the Burn out 73 shock water also for about 6hrs. Sprayed everything off again and hooked it all back up. Added 6 bags of the burnout 73 to the pool and ran the pump another 24hrs. The next day we put a pool RX in the skimmer basket and returned to maintenance. It killed the algae and we haven't struggled since. We prep our pool for winter in Fall( Oct.) I clean the filters and add 4 bags of shock and the initial 6oz of this algaecide 1 day apart at night, run pump 4 to 6 hrs each night, add chlorine tabs as needed that's it. For Summer start up (end of Apr./ beginning of May) I clean filters and at night add 4 bags of shock and brush the pool, next day add the the initial 6oz of this algaecide, next day a new Pool RX in the skimmer basket and 4 chlorine tabs in float. Running pool pump 8hrs each night in the summer. I have had no algae issues for the last 4yrs. with this maintenance combination during the summer: 4 chlorine tabs in float, 2 bags of shock and 3oz of algaecide. I do this every other week 1 day apart between shock and algaecide, and of course 1 pool rx at beginning of summer in skimmer basket. I don't even do chemical testing anymore. I have clear, clean, blue pool. I use BioGuard burnout 73 shock. Which has 73= % of Calcium Hypochlorite in each bag. Pool filters need cleaning at least 2 more times each yr.( so usually Oct.,Jan., Apr.,July). This is for a 15,000 gallon pebble tek in ground pool. It might sound like a lot of work, but once you get the algae under control the maintenance is easy. We don't struggle, we're not throwing money away and we're not adding extra unnecessary chemicals. ... show more
